Schwab Technology Services enables the future of how clients manage their money by providinginnovative and reliable technology products and services as part of our ongoing commitment to democratize access to investing and financial planning.
As a DevOps Technical Lead, you will play a critical role in advancing modern software engineering practices, strengthening CI/CD reliability and standardization, and accelerating engineering productivity through responsible adoption of AI-assisted development and automation. This role combines hands-on technical leadership with strategic influence, partnering across Engineering, Security, Risk/Compliance, and Operations to deliver secure, scalable, and repeatable releases in a highly regulated environment.
You will lead the design and continuous improvement of CI/CD pipelines and automation workflows, ensuring consistency, auditability, and operational readiness throughout the software development lifecycle. By embedding quality gates, automated testing, and security controls directly into delivery pipelines, you will improve release confidence while reducing risk. You will also enhance the developer experience by creating reusable templates, enabling self-service delivery patterns, and coaching engineers to adopt best practices in workflow automation, testing, and system design.
In this role, you will contribute directly to production-grade code, guide architecture decisions, and mentor engineers to strengthen technical capabilities across teams. You will work collaboratively with cross-functional partners to align on delivery priorities, resolve complex challenges, and continuously improve system reliability, scalability, and maintainability. Your ability to apply analytical thinking, problem-solving, and sound decision-making will be essential in driving outcomes that improve speed, quality, and resilience across the engineering ecosystem.
As a Technical Lead, you will own the end-to-end CI/CD experience-from build and test through promotion and deployment-by establishing standardized, governed pipeline patterns that are secure, reliable, scalable, and audit-ready. You'll accelerate delivery outcomes by embedding quality gates, security scanning, and automation-first practices, while also advancing responsible AI adoption to improve engineering throughput.

Required Qualifications:
- 7+ years of experience in software engineering and/or platform engineering, including demonstrated technical leadership (e.g., Technical Lead, Lead Engineer, or Senior Engineer owning major systems)
- 1-2 years Ai software development experience, such as GitHub CoPilot.
- Proven expertise in building and operating CI/CD pipelines, including workflow automation, environment management, release orchestration, and quality gate implementation
- Experience with modern DevOps toolchains such as GitHub-based workflows, artifact management, feature flagging, and automated testing platforms
- Strong proficiency in software development lifecycle (SDLC) practices, including pipeline authoring, testing strategies, and code quality standards
- Hands-on development experience in at least one major programming stack (e.g., Java or C#/.NET), with strong fundamentals in application development, design patterns, and code review practices
- Practical experience integrating secure SDLC practices, including implementing security controls such as secrets scanning, policy-based checks, and automated compliance validations
- Demonstrated ability to apply analytical thinking, problem-solving, and decision-making skills to improve system reliability, scalability, and delivery outcomes
- Strong collaboration and communication skills, with the ability to work effectively across cross-functional teams and translate technical concepts into business impact
Preferred Qualifications:
- Experience working in a regulated environment with exposure to audit, risk, compliance, or change management processes
- Familiarity with infrastructure-as-code and cloud delivery patterns (e.g., Terraform, cloud platforms, or platform-as-a-service environments)
- Experience leveraging AI-assisted development tools or coding assistants and contributing to team-level best practices for responsible and effective adoption
